Concrete Foundation Repair in Jamestown, CO
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over projects such as stabilizing settling foundations, repairing cracks, addressing bowing or shifting walls, and restoring structural support for residential and commercial properties. Property owners often seek foundation repair when noticing signs like u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, aiming to prevent further damage and preserve the safety of their home or building.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es behind foundation movement, and the best methods for stabilization. It’s important to evaluate whether repairs are needed for minor cracks or more significant structural issues, and to consider the long-term impact of different repair options. Proper assessment and planning can help ensure that repairs effectively address underlying problems and support the property's stability over time.

Common Concrete Foundation Repair Jobs
Cracked or settling foundations - repairs to stabilize and prevent further damage.
Leaning or bowing walls - reinforcement to restore structural integrity.
Uneven floors or misaligned walls - corrective work to improve home safety and appearance.
Water infiltration issues - sealing and waterproofing to protect the foundation.
Foundation cracks or gaps - filling and sealing to prevent water and pest intrusion.
Basement or crawl space foundation issues - repairs to enhance stability and prevent moisture problems.
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What signs indicate a foundation needs repair? C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ick can signal foundation issues.
What types of foundation repairs are common? Common repairs include underpinning, crack sealing, and slab stabilization to address settling or shifting.
Can foundation problems affect property value? Yes, foundation issues can impact property value and should be addressed to maintain structural integrity.
What should property owners consider before repair work? It's important to assess the extent of damage and choose repairs that restore stability and prevent future issues.
